The Office of Diversity proudly announces the formation of the ASU Quality Teaching Circle Initiative. The purpose of this initiative is to promote excellence in teaching, research and service among minority faculty members by creating positive and safe environments for faculty members to exchange ideas, receive enriching criticism, express concerns and access a university-wide support system.
The QTCI will meet quarterly with a faculty member either presenting initial research efforts or facilitating a discussion on a topic of interest. Benefits and topical coverage will include:
* Establishment of a forum for minority faculty members to discuss concerns, and receive guidance, in the areas of teaching, research and service.
* Encourage formal and informal mentorship relations between junior and senior faculty.
* Discuss personal research agendas, pending research proposals and receive feedback prior to journal submission or conference presentation.
* Discuss issues associated with teaching predominately white classes.
* Discuss improving overall teaching skills.
* Best practices in navigating the promotion, retention and tenure process.
* Best practices in managing difficult personalities and resolving conflict.
